CAPESIZES UP, PANAMAXES DOWN - BRS
It was Capesizes up, Panamaxes down this week as the latter experienced a correction after its recent gains. Period rates for Panamaxes remain firm however, so a big slide was not expected in the short term. In the coal market, South Africa’s Richards Bay terminal confirmed a sharp rise in Asian exports, which rose to 42% of total shipments in the first quarter of this year, up from 25% a year earlier – due mainly to Chinese and Indian demand. In Europe, Thyssenkrupp became the first European buyer to confirm it had agreed an iron ore price on a quarterly basis. In line with the Japanese contracts, it also reported a 100% price increase, back-dated to April 1. Meanwhile China confirmed steelmaker Pangang Group would be combined with Angang Steel and Benxi Iron and Steel. The merger will create the country’s largest steel group.
Supra/Handy
The Handy/Supramax markets stayed firm and stable in the Atlantic throughout the week, while in the Pacific basin the market was also healthy but with less activity and a softening tendency. Supramaxes from West Africa were fetching close to US$ 30,000 per day for trips via ECSA to Continent and closer to low US$ 40,000s for trips out to the East. The USG and ECUS also remained very firm with trips USG to the Med paying in the high US$ 40,000s, and above US$50,000 for trips out. Scrap cargoes from the Continent to the Med are paying Supramax units in the low US$ 30,000s TC equivalent.
The transatlantic round on Supramax was negociated in the low US$ 30,000s level towards the end of the week. Looking at the Pacific market now, India softened during the week with WC stems to China paying in the very low US$ 30,000s TC equivalent on large units and about the same levels from EC India. Supras for Richards Bay rounds back to India were paying in the mid/high US$ 20,000s and it is becoming difficult to persuade owners to finish trips in WC India with Monsoon kicking in.
Nopac and Aussie rounds saw larger units fixed in the low-mid US$ 20,000s, while Indonesia/India and Indo/China rounds were fixed closer to mid US$ 20,000s level depending on delivery point. There were few short period candidates in the Far East but large Supras are seeing close to mid US$ 20,000s levels.
Panamax
A continued slump in the market saw rates slip further on the week. The BPI fell 7% to finish the week at 3,757 points, while the four time charter average closed at US$ 30,239. The Atlantic lacked any fresh enquiry and although there was a clear-out of early tonnage, rates remain under pressure for now, although charterers with stems ex north Continent found tonnage a lot more positional. In the Pacific, the South American grain market continued to serve tonnage out east but again here rates had slipped to around US$ 28,000. The Australia and north Pacific round voyages too came off with less fresh enquiry and deals were being fixed at close to the US$ 30,000 mark. The longer term period market saw a 12 month deal concluded with delivery in the east for prompt dates at a steady US$ 28,000 level.
Capesize
An 8% leap in the four time charter average this week, with rates finishing the week at US$ 28,441. The rise was mainly achieved on the back of strong Atlantic rates where activity picked up noticeably. There was again little period business although a 177,000 dwt vessel ex yard in May was reported fixed at 2 years for US$ 31,500. The market will continue to watch what impact the new, higher commodity prices will have on demand. The BCI inched up 39 points on Monday, with some expectations of a further increase this week.
Source: BRS Dry Bulk
